MasterChef Australia Judge and Acclaimed Chef Jock Zonfrillo passed at Age 46

The culinary world is in mourning following the death of Jock Zonfrillo, a beloved chef and MasterChef Australia judge, who died on May 1st, 2023, at 46. Zonfrillo was known for his innovative cuisine, passion for indigenous ingredients, and commitment to elevating the voices of First Nations communities in Australia.

Who was Jock Zonfrillo?

Born in Scotland in 1976, Jock Zonfrillo was a highly acclaimed chef who trained under some of the world’s most renowned culinary masters, including Marco Pierre White and Raymond Blanc. He moved to Australia in 2000, where he quickly made a name for himself with his inventive, seasonally-driven cuisine. In 2013, he opened his restaurant, Orana, in Adelaide, which won numerous awards and accolades for its innovative use of indigenous ingredients.

What were Jock Zonfrillo’s contributions to the culinary world?

In addition to his success as a chef, Zonfrillo was also known for his work as an advocate for indigenous communities in Australia. He founded the Orana Foundation in 2016, which works to preserve and promote the use of native Australian ingredients in cooking. He was also a judge on MasterChef Australia for four seasons, where he was known for his kind and constructive feedback and his passion for showcasing the diversity of Australian cuisine.

What was the cause of Jock Zonfrillo’s demise?

The cause of Zonfrillo’s death has not been disclosed. However, his family released a statement saying he had passed away “suddenly and peacefully” at his home in Adelaide. The information also thanked his friends and colleagues in the culinary world for their outpouring of support and love.

How are fans and the culinary community mourning Jock Zonfrillo’s passing?

News of Zonfrillo’s death has been met with an outpouring of grief and tributes from fans and colleagues in the culinary world. Many chefs, including Gordon Ramsay and Massimo Bottura, took to social media to share their memories of working with Zonfrillo and to express their condolences to his family. MasterChef Australia released a statement saying Zonfrillo was “an incredible chef, judge, and friend to the show” who would be deeply missed.
